Ghibli Museum
Museum
4.6
Step into a dreamlike world filled with Miyazaki-style details, exclusive short films, and the iconic Cat Bus. Tickets are by advance reservation only and sell out quickly, so plan well ahead. A must-visit for Studio Ghibli fans.

Tokyo National Museum
Museum
4.5
Immerse yourself in Japanese art and history at the country's oldest and largest museum. Its vast collection includes Buddhist statues, samurai swords, and ukiyo-e prints. Perfect for a leisurely indoor day exploring Japan's rich cultural heritage.
